Among the options provided, the Permian extinction, also known as the Permian-Triassic extinction or the Great Dying, is widely considered the most catastrophic and greatest mass extinction event in Earth's history. This event occurred around 252 million years ago, marking the boundary between the Permian and Triassic periods.
The Permian extinction resulted in a significant loss of biodiversity, with an estimated 96% of marine species and 70% of terrestrial species going extinct. It affected a wide range of organisms, including marine invertebrates, plants, insects, and vertebrates. The cause of the Permian extinction is believed to be a combination of various factors, including volcanic activity, global warming, oceanic anoxia (lack of oxygen in the oceans), and subsequent disruptions to the global carbon cycle.
The Cretaceous extinction, often referred to as the K-T extinction, is also a well-known mass extinction event. It occurred around 66 million years ago and led to the extinction of the dinosaurs, along with many other species. This extinction event was likely triggered by a combination of factors, including a large asteroid impact (as evidenced by the Chicxulub crater in Mexico) and volcanic activity. While the Cretaceous extinction had significant global consequences, it is generally considered less catastrophic in terms of overall species loss compared to the Permian extinction.
The Ordovician extinction and the Pleistocene extinction, on the other hand, were significant extinction events but not as extensive or catastrophic as the Permian or Cretaceous extinctions. The Ordovician extinction, which occurred around 443 million years ago, primarily affected marine life, particularly brachiopods, trilobites, and conodonts. The Pleistocene extinction, also known as the Quaternary extinction, happened relatively recently between 2.6 million and 11,700 years ago and involved the disappearance of many large mammals, including mammoths and saber-toothed cats. While these extinctions were significant, they were not as severe in terms of overall species loss compared to the Permian and Cretaceous extinctions.

what mountain chain marks the eastern boundary of europe? (found in russia)
The mountain chain that marks the eastern boundary of Europe, found in Russia, is the Ural Mountains. The Ural Mountains serve as a natural boundary between the continents of Europe and Asia. Stretching over 2,500 kilometers (1,553 miles) from the Arctic Ocean in the north to the Ural River in the south, they are often considered the dividing line between the two continents.
The Ural Mountains have played a significant role in shaping the history and culture of the region. They have been a source of valuable minerals and resources, contributing to the economic development of both Europe and Asia. Additionally, the mountains have influenced the climate of the surrounding areas, creating distinct differences between the European and Asian sides.
The western slopes of the Ural Mountains receive more precipitation than the eastern slopes, which results in a denser and more diverse range of plant and animal life. This difference in biodiversity can be attributed to the mountains acting as a barrier to the movement of air masses, causing variations in climate and vegetation on either side of the range.
Throughout history, the Ural Mountains have also served as a natural defense barrier for various nations and empires. They have been crossed by numerous trade routes and have witnessed the passage of various armies and migrations, making them an important part of the region's history.
In summary, the Ural Mountains mark the eastern boundary of Europe, found in Russia, and play a crucial role in dividing the continents of Europe and Asia. They impact the region's climate, biodiversity, and history, as well as contribute to its economic development through the extraction of valuable resources.

_______ is the extremely slow downslope granular flow of regolith.
Creep is the extremely slow downslope granular flow of regolith.
Creep is the slow and continuous movement of soil or rock downhill due to the force of gravity. This movement can occur over a long period of time and is typically caused by the downslope flow of regolith, which is the layer of loose, fragmented material covering solid rock. Creep is often caused by repeated cycles of freezing and thawing, which can loosen the soil and cause it to shift downhill. Other factors that can contribute to creep include rainfall, temperature changes, and the slope of the land. While creep is typically slow and not immediately noticeable, it can cause significant damage to structures built on sloping ground over time. Therefore, it is important to consider the potential for creep when building on sloping land and to take appropriate measures to prevent damage.

Which of the following is NOT a type of opening along which weathering agents attack bedrock?
a. solution cavities
b. faults
c. batholiths
d. joints
e. lava vesicles
The answer to the question is c. batholiths. Batholiths are large, intrusive igneous rocks that form deep within the Earth's crust.
They are not openings along which weathering agents attack bedrock. Weathering agents such as water, wind, and ice attack bedrock along joints, faults, solution cavities, and lava vesicles. Joints are fractures in the rock that form due to stress and strain, and they provide openings for water and other agents to penetrate into the bedrock. Faults are similar to joints, but they involve movement along the fracture. Solution cavities are openings that form when water dissolves minerals in the bedrock, and they can become larger over time. Lava vesicles are openings that form when gas bubbles are trapped in lava as it cools, and they can also become larger over time as weathering agents attack the surrounding rock.
It is important to understand the different types of openings along which weathering agents attack bedrock because this can help us understand the landscape around us. For example, areas with high levels of jointing may be more susceptible to erosion and landslides, while areas with many solution cavities may be prone to sinkholes. By understanding these processes, we can better manage and protect our natural resources.

circulation in the troposphere is mainly a(n) ________ system.
The circulation in the troposphere is mainly a convective system. The troposphere is the layer of the Earth's atmosphere closest to the surface.
It is where weather occurs and where we live. The circulation in the troposphere is primarily driven by the uneven heating of the Earth's surface by the sun. This causes warm air to rise and cooler air to sink, creating a convective system. The movement of air in the troposphere is also influenced by the rotation of the Earth and the Coriolis effect, which causes the air to move in a curved path. This creates large-scale wind patterns, such as the trade winds and the jet stream. The circulation in the troposphere is important for distributing heat and moisture around the planet, which affects weather and climate. It also plays a role in air pollution and the transport of pollutants across long distances. Overall, the convective system in the troposphere is a complex and dynamic process that is essential for the functioning of the Earth's atmosphere.

the steepest angle at which unconsolidated granular material remains stable is ________.
The steepest angle at which unconsolidated granular material remains stable is called the angle of repose.
This angle varies based on the size, shape, and cohesiveness of the granular material. The angle of repose is determined by pouring the material onto a flat surface and slowly raising one end until the material begins to slide. The steeper the angle, the less stable the material becomes, and it will eventually slide downhill. The angle of repose is an important factor to consider in many industries, such as mining and construction, where it can impact the safety of workers and the stability of structures. Understanding the angle of repose can also help in designing structures and machinery to prevent potential collapses or accidents.

Many of the poor on the periphery of cities in less developed countries live in areas known as. answer choices. squatter settlements. public housing.
Many of the poor on the periphery of cities in less developed countries live in areas known as squatter settlements.
Hence, the correct answer is Squatter settlements.
What is a Squatter Settlement?
A squatter settlement is an informal or unplanned housing area, typically on the outskirts of urban areas, where people reside without legal ownership or occupancy rights to the land or the structures they live in.
Squatter settlements are usually built on land that is not suitable for regular housing or is designated for public use. These settlements often lack basic services and amenities such as clean water, sanitation, electricity, and waste disposal, etc.
Squatter settlements can be found in many developing countries around the world, and they are often home to some of the poorest and most vulnerable people in those countries.

external processes include weathering, mass wasting, and ________.
External processes include weathering, mass wasting, and erosion. External processes are those that occur on the surface of the Earth and are driven by external forces such as gravity, wind, water, and ice.
Weathering is the breakdown of rocks and minerals on the Earth's surface, caused by exposure to the elements such as rain, wind, and temperature changes. Mass wasting, also known as slope failure, is the movement of soil and rock downhill under the influence of gravity. Erosion, on the other hand, is the process by which soil, rock, and sediment are transported by wind, water, or ice from one location to another. It is a natural process that can occur over a short period or over millions of years. The combined effect of these external processes shapes the Earth's surface, creating mountains, valleys, canyons, and other landforms. Understanding these processes is important for geologists, engineers, and environmental scientists to assess the impact of natural hazards, such as landslides and floods, and to develop strategies for managing them.

A fragmental, extrusive igneous rock is referred to as which of the following?
a. crystalline
b. vitric
c. pyroclastic
d. vesicular
Answer: The correct answer is c.) pyroclastic
Explanation: A pyroclastic rock is a type of fragmental, extrusive igneous rock that is formed from volcanic ash, pumice, and other volcanic debris that has been ejected during an explosive volcanic eruption. Pyroclastic rocks are characterized by their fragmented and irregular texture, which is the result of their explosive formation.
Crystalline rocks are igneous rocks that have a distinct crystalline structure, formed from the slow cooling and solidification of magma or lava. Vitric rocks are igneous rocks that have a glassy texture, formed from the rapid cooling of lava or magma. Vesicular rocks are igneous rocks that contain many small, rounded cavities or vesicles, formed by the expansion of gas bubbles within the lava or magma as it cools and solidifies.

T/F Most galaxies are members of some sort of cluster of galaxies.
True. Most galaxies are members of some sort of cluster of galaxies. Clusters of galaxies are collections of hundreds or thousands of galaxies that are held together by their mutual gravity.
These clusters are the largest known structures in the universe, and they can span several million light-years across. The Milky Way, for example, is a member of the Local Group, which is a small cluster of galaxies that also includes the Andromeda galaxy and several smaller galaxies. In addition to clusters, there are also superclusters, which are even larger structures that contain multiple clusters of galaxies. The existence of clusters and superclusters suggests that galaxies are not distributed randomly throughout the universe but are instead organized into large-scale structures. This structure is thought to have arisen from the tiny fluctuations in the density of matter that were present in the early universe. As gravity caused these fluctuations to grow, they eventually led to the formation of clusters and superclusters, which are the dominant structures in the universe today.
